If you don’t count “Cover You”, it has been two years since the last Morning Musume full-length release. Here is another set of opinions on their new album…
OnDiet reviews the non-single tracks, and gives each song a “one phrase” thought such as “epic”, “odd”, and “sexy” Unlike in the previous set of reviews, she likes both Aika and Sayu’s’s solo efforts, and of course she is totally enamored with Kataomoi no Owari ni. But although it is an Eri-worship blog, Risa’s performance here gets the best review. OnDiet feels she totally outsung Reina and Ai on Jounetsu no Kiss wo Hitotsu.
Greg wondered if the new tracks would make the album worth purchasing. He notes a transition from the traditional Genki style to a more Urban Contemporary feel. After hearing them on two different tracks, he feels that Ai, Risa and Reina would make a great sub-unit! Now there’s a thought…And his answer to his opening question is a resounding YES!
Amyrulez starts his review with the album cover itself. He likes the cute outfits, but he hates the wigs! I have to admit that their hairstyles do look pretty strange. As for the music, he feels this is the “‘Perfect Platinum album’” Some of his favorites include Jounetsu no Kiss and Kataomoi no Owari ni…, but my favorite part of the review is his take on the title of Guruguru Jump, and what the Malay translation might look like, Bwahahaha!
Siggy also notices how much different this album sounds from MoMusu’s previous efforts. He gives it a seven out of ten. However most of his positive feedback is for the single tracks. The new songs don’t fare as well. He did like Jounetsu no Kiss, but the three solo songs were not among his favorites, to say the least!
So to summarize it seems like SONGS is a winner, as are the Ai/Risa/Reina tracks. Eri’s solo gets the best feedback. Aika’s not so much. As for Guruguru Jump and It’s You…well, at least they get you smiling. For better or worse.
